Trains from Brecht to Namur run on average 11 times per day, taking around 2h 40m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£22 if you book in advance.

The earliest train runs at 06:17, the last at 19:33. The fastest train covers the 100 km distance in 2h 9m.

About
SNCB is Belgium’s national railway company and the country’s main train operator, offering First Class and Second Class tickets. It runs a variety of services, including Intercity trains for the fastest domestic connections, Interregio trains with more local stops, and international options such as EuroCity, Thalys, and ICE International. Thalys trains connect Belgium with France, Germany, and the Netherlands at high speed, while EuroCity and ICE International link Belgium to Germany and other European destinations. Onboard facilities typically include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and power outlets. Popular routes include Brussels to Antwerp, Brussels to Bruges, Brussels to Ghent, and Brussels to Liège.

For a fulfilling experience in Namur, two to three days are generally sufficient to explore its main attractions, such as the Citadel of Namur, the historic Old Town, and the Felicien Rops Museum.
